Python入门

**Python一些常用的函数**
一.字符串常见操作
1.pow(a,b)#a的b次方
2.str.lower() str.upper()#将字符串字符全部变为大写或者小写
3.str.split(sep) #函数返回一个列表,列表中的数值用sep字符分割,例如逗号.
4.str.count(sub)#返回子字符串在字符串中出现的次数
5.str.replace(old,new)#字符串str中所有old字串都被替换为new
6.str.center(width[,fillchar])#依据填充字符居中显示字符串,其中填充字符可选
6.str.strip(chars) #从左侧右侧开始,删除str字符串中含有chars中的字符
7.str.join(iter) # ",".join("123456") -> "1,2,3,4,5,6"
二.字符串格式化
1."{}算{}网{}".format("计","机","络") #字符串即为"计算机网络"
"{1}算{0}网{2}".format("计","机","络")#字符串即为"机算计网络"
2.具体用法参见下图
![format格式化输出]
![format格式化输出示例1]
![format格式化输出示例2]
3.关于字符串的函数还有len(),str(),hex(),oct(),chr(),ord(),+,* #计算字符串长度,打印非字符串比如数字,十六进制打印数字,八进制打印数字,依据Unicode编码打印字符,依据字符打印Unicode编码,字符串连接,幂指数打印字符串
5.str[m:n:k]#截取子字符串,参数k表示步长可以省略
三.关于time库的使用
1.时间获取time(),ctime()#time返回浮点数不易读,ctime返回字符串易读
2.strftime(spl,g)#spl是格式化字符串,g是计算机内部时间类型的变量
eg:g = gmtime() time.strftime("%Y-%m-%d %H:%M:%S",gmtime)#其他可选参数a星期简写,A星期全写,H24小时格式,h12小时格式,P上下午,B月份全写,b月份简写
3.strptime(g,spl) #g是字符串形式的时间值 spl是格式化模板字符串,用来定义输入效果

格式化输出字符串
示例1
示例2

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值